High-technology exports (current US$) for Liberia



Indicator Definition:
High-technology exports are products with high R&D intensity, such as aerospace, computers, pharmaceuticals, scientific instruments, and electrical machinery. Data are in current U.S. dollars.

The indicator "High-technology exports (current US$)" stands at 0.098 Million usd as of 12/31/2023.
